A field experiment was conducted to study the on farm crop response to plant nutrients in pre dominant cropping system i.e. rice, (Oryza sativa) - chickpea (Cicer arietinum) and their impact on productivity, soil fertility and economics at Kabirdham district of Chhattisgarh state during 2013-14 and 2014-15. The results revealed that application of 100 kg N, 60 kg P2O5, 40 kg K2O and 20 kg ZnSO4 /ha to rice and 20 kg N, 50 kg P2O5, 20 kg K2O /ha to chickpea recorded significantly higher grain and straw/ haulm yields. Integrated effect of organic, inorganic and biofertilizers on crop yield and N,P and K uptake under rainfed maize-wheat cropping system and available nutrients during 2015- 2016 is being studied in sandy loam at Jammu under the INM maize-wheat trial. The results revealed that the application of recommended levels of NPK to maize-wheat with FYM, VC and biofertilizers (Azotobacter and phosphate solubilizing bacteria) resulted in grain 66.53 per cent and straw 13.00 per cent increase over control in maize and wheat yields, respectively. The present research study has been conducted with prime objective to investigate the effect of manure and fertilizers on chemical fractions of Fe and Mn under rice-wheat system. Laboratory analysis was made on the soil samples collected (October 2013) from an on-going long-term field experiment (in progress since Kharif2009-10) at Department of Soil Science, PAU, Ludhiana. The organic manure through bio gas slurry (BGS) @ 6 t ha-1 was incorporated along with nitrogen (N @ 80 and 120 kg ha-1 ), phosphorus (P @ 30 kg ha-1 ) and potassium fertilizer (K @ 30 kg ha-1 ) to the rice crop.
